Sea Fishing Experience from Reykjavik: Comfortable Boat, Experienced Guides, and Provided Equipment

Experience the ultimate fishing excursion in Reykjavik! Venture out on a cozy boat accompanied by seasoned guides who will enlighten you about Icelandic fishing practices. We furnish fishing rods, protective gear, and additional equipment to ensure the highest likelihood of reeling in species like cod, halibut, haddock, rockfish, and pollock.

Great Trip - Great fishing trips, with a very friendly crew. 13 guests and 3 crew on board. 30-40 mins cruise out to open water. Caught lots of Pollock, which was all thrown back, moved location and then hit the Cod. Good sized fish, with all fishers catching at least one. Had 3 location moves, to get the best fishing. One of the crew filleted and Barbequed the fish. Potatoes in the oven, which gave us a very tasty dinner on the cruise back to Harbour. Would definitely do it again, and highly recommend to others.
